Buying Guide: Key Points To Compare 4 AWG Marine Cables

  • Conductor material and tinning: Tinned copper offers better corrosion resistance and conductivity in saltwater environments.
  • Insulation and jacket: Look for thick, durable PVC or other marine-grade insulation to resist salt, UV, heat, and abrasion.
  • Length and layout: Choose duplex or dual-color bundles for easier wiring—and ensure you have appropriate slack for routing around compartments.
  • Flexibility and strand count: Higher strand counts improve flexibility for tight spaces and vibration-prone areas.
  • Lug compatibility: Confirm lug size and termination options (crimp, solder, heat shrink) match your battery terminals and equipment.
  • Intended use: Separate marine battery wiring, solar panel leads, shore power, and accessory runs may require different gauges or configurations.
  • Durability in harsh weather: Corrosion resistance, insulation quality, and temperature tolerance determine longevity in boats and RVs.

Frequently Asked Questions

  1. What does 4 AWG mean for marine cables?
    – It refers to the American Wire Gauge size, indicating a thicker conductor suitable for higher current and longer runs on boats and outdoor vehicles.
  2. Is tin-plated copper better for marine use?
    – Yes, tinning improves corrosion resistance in saltwater and humid environments, helping maintain conductivity over time.
  3. Should I buy a duplex 4 AWG wire or two separate runs?
    – Duplex can simplify wiring in tight spaces and keep red/black conductors bundled, but two separate runs may offer more routing flexibility in complex layouts.
  4. What length is ideal for battery wiring on a boat?
    – Choose a length that reaches the battery bank, alternator, or inverter with extra slack for future adjustments, avoiding excessive excess that adds clutter.
  5. Can these cables be used for solar panel wiring?
    – Yes, many 4 AWG marine cables are suitable for solar inverters and battery banks, provided voltage ratings and insulation are appropriate for your system.
  6. Do I need special lugs or crimpers?
    – Depending on the product, you may need compatible lugs and a crimping tool or heat shrink to ensure a sealed, durable connection.
